
Knighthawks Announce Roster Moves
March 11, 2020 - National Lacrosse League (NLL)
Rochester Knighthawks News Release
(Rochester, NY) - Rochester Knighthawks General Manager and Vice President of Lacrosse Operations Dan Carey announced today that the team has released forward Mark Cockerton, placed transition man Chris Willman on the holdout list and activated defenseman Dustyn Pratt off the practice squad. Additionally, defenseman Travis Burton has been assigned to the practice squad from injured reserved. All four transactions are pending league approval.
Cockerton appeared in three games with the Knighthawks, producing two goals and four assists for six points. The Oshawa, Ontario, native registered 22 shots while also collecting 13 loose balls.
In 28 career games between the former Knighthawks franchise, New England Black Wolves and current Rochester franchise, Cockerton, a former first-round selection (sixth overall) in the 2014 NLL Entry Draft, has recorded 17 goals and 22 assists for 39 points while also totaling 100 loose balls and 110 shots on goal.
Willman has appeared in eight games with the Knighthawks this season, recording five assists and 29 loose ball recoveries while also winning 44 of 104 face-off attempts.
Pratt collected a pair of loose balls in Rochester's 13-12 victory over New York on Feb. 29, which also served as his professional debut.
Burton made his season debut with the Knighthawks on Dec. 28 against the Toronto Rock, recording one shot and one loose ball in the contest.
